This shouldn't be required for full highstates since we always include the common SLS on not-Windows:

saltfs/top.sls

Lines 4 to 7 in f50214b

'not G@os:Windows':
- match: compound
- admin
- common
.
However, this is still an improvement in the case that someone uses state.sls to selectively run the buildbot.slave SLS, so it's good to have (helps with #496).
